Hi reception team — quick heads-up about the roof-terrace door at Quayside House. It's jamming again, so if anyone heads up for a break, warn them to prop it carefully or they'll be knocking to get back in. Facilities are on it, fix due Friday. Meanwhile, staff can come back in via the maintenance stair door using the keypad. The code is below.

turnstile pass: bdg-YPPQB-52010

Runbook: GarageGlance occupancy feed

If the Harborview Deck occupancy feed goes stale (no updates for 5+ minutes), first check the sensor gateway health page. Green but stale usually means the aggregator queue is backed up; restart the aggregator via the ops console and counts should recover within two minutes. If spots show negative numbers, force a full recount from the camera snapshots. When escalating to engineering, include the trace token shown below.

session token of yawif-kahof = htk9_dd6996ed6

**Alert: planner-regression-ordersvc** — Heads up for the sync: after last Tuesday's Graywick upgrade, the query planner started picking a sequential scan on the orders join, and p95 latency roughly tripled. We've pinned the old plan as a stopgap, but it's fragile. Triage notes, query plans, and the rollback discussion are collected on the internal page.

runbook for tafof-yawif: https://confluence.tolvaqsys.internal/display/display/browse/pages/7be3

## Authentication

The Ledgermill report builder now guarantees stable sorting: rows with equal keys preserve insertion order across exports. To verify this in staging before the weekly sync, the test harness must authenticate against the Sortproof validation service. Auth uses a single header-based key; no OAuth flow is involved. Requests without it return 401 and the stability checks silently skip. The current Sortproof key follows.

gateway credential: kto3_qfe

## Formula sandbox tuning

User-supplied formulas in Gridmoor execute inside a restricted interpreter with hard ceilings on time, memory, and call depth. Reviewers should confirm any change to these ceilings is justified in the PR description, since raising them widens the abuse surface. Defaults were chosen from production traces. The current limits are as follows.

limits module of tafog-fawip:
WEIGHTS = {
    "julix": 57,
    "lamys": 992,
    "kasvan": 209,
    "quenok": 750,
    "alddor": 259,
    "oliath": 1009,
    "wenix": 815,
}